The Kairos Blanket Exercise is an interactive workshop that invites participants to engage with the historical and ongoing impacts of colonization on Indigenous Peoples in Canada. Through guided storytelling and reflection, participants deepen their understanding of treaties, land dispossession, and Indigenous resilience, supporting meaningful learning related to reconciliation and Indigenous鈥憇ettler relations.

The workshop is two hours long, with the first hour dedicated to the interactive Kairos Blanket Exercise, followed by a second hour of guided reflection and debrief.
